Background technology
Pouring bus groove is to use high performance insulating resin pouring bus groove, and busbar is directly poured into a mould to sealing, protection etc. Level reaches IP68, has the Novel non-metal outer shell bus slot of the four anti-functions such as waterproof, fire prevention, anti-corrosion, explosion-proof.
When carrying out bus cast, casting mold need to be used, is shaped.The casting mold now used is integrated more Formula, or spliced, integral type casting mold exist more specification fix, breakdown maintenance inconvenience the problem of, it is and conventional spliced Casting mold structure is mostly old structure, and combined and spliced effect is poor, and centering effect is relatively poor, and splicing precision cannot protect Barrier, and then cause pouring bus groove intelligence connection to be present more.

Embodiment
A kind of cast bus die side plate section bar as depicted, including side plate main 1, it is characterised in that the side plate The side of main body 1 is provided with adapter sleeve 3, connecting plate 2 and hydraulically extensible bar 4;The quantity of the adapter sleeve 3 is 4,4 connections Set 3 is symmetrical arranged up and down, respectively at square four angle that the side of side plate main 1 is in;Each adapter sleeve 3 It is made up of 2 combinations of clamping block 5, clamping block 5 is C-shaped, and 2 clamping blocks 5 are symmetrical set, and grafting is left between 2 clamping blocks 5 Mouthful, the interface is in trapezoidal shape;
4 adapter sleeves 3 opsition dependent division, it is the first connection set group 7 on the right of the side of side plate main 1 respectively Set group 8 is connected with positioned at the second of the side left side of side plate main 1;
The quantity of the connecting plate 2 is 2, and 2 horizontal parallels of connecting plate 2 are set, and the section of connecting plate 2 is in trapezoidal shape, Connecting plate 2 inserts interface, is connected the grafting of set group 7 with first and gap coordinates;One end of 2 connecting plates 2 passes through synchronized links Bar 9 is connected, and the hydraulically extensible bar 4 is hand-hydraulic expansion link, one end of hydraulically extensible bar 4 with being fixed by fixed block 10, The other end is fixedly connected with the middle part of synchronous connecting rod 9;
The surface of the side of the side plate main 1 is provided with the gib block 11 of protrusion, and the quantity of the gib block 11 is 2 Individual, 2 horizontal parallels of gib block 11 are set, and are passed through from the middle part of adapter sleeve 3, the section semicircular in shape of gib block 11, the company The side of fishplate bar 2 is provided with guide groove 12, and the guide groove 12 is with gib block 11 for cooperation, its section semicircular in shape;
Further, the side both ends of the side plate main 1 are provided with fastener 13.
As shown in figure 3, being docked between multiple side plate mains by connecting plate and adapter sleeve, have self centering Effect, connecting plate are designed using trapezoidal shape, come with oblique veneer, be can effectively ensure that and are spliced precision between multiple side plate mains, Connective stability is finally strengthened by fastener again;
The motion of connecting plate is controlled by hydraulically extensible bar, while connecting plate is oriented to by gib block and guide groove, control, motion Accurately, side plate main splicing precision and splicing efficiency are improved.
